<?php namespace JMS\Serializer\Tests\Serializer\Doctrine; use Doctrine\Common\Annotations\AnnotationReader; use Doctrine\Common\Annotations\Reader; use Doctrine\Common\Persistence\AbstractManagerRegistry; use Doctrine\Common\Persistence\ManagerRegistry; use Doctrine\DBAL\Connection; use Doctrine\DBAL\DriverManager; use Doctrine\ORM\Configuration; use Doctrine\ORM\EntityManager; use Doctrine\ORM\Mapping\Driver\AnnotationDriver; use Doctrine\ORM\ORMException; use Doctrine\ORM\Tools\SchemaTool; use JMS\Serializer\Builder\CallbackDriverFactory; use JMS\Serializer\Builder\DefaultDriverFactory; use JMS\Serializer\Metadata\Driver\DoctrineTypeDriver; use JMS\Serializer\Serializer; use JMS\Serializer\SerializerBuilder; use JMS\Serializer\Tests\Fixtures\Doctrine\SingleTableInheritance\Clazz; use JMS\Serializer\Tests\Fixtures\Doctrine\SingleTableInheritance\Excursion; use JMS\Serializer\Tests\Fixtures\Doctrine\SingleTableInheritance\Organization; use JMS\Serializer\Tests\Fixtures\Doctrine\SingleTableInheritance\Person; use JMS\Serializer\Tests\Fixtures\Doctrine\SingleTableInheritance\School; use JMS\Serializer\Tests\Fixtures\Doctrine\SingleTableInheritance\Student; use JMS\Serializer\Tests\Fixtures\Doctrine\SingleTableInheritance\Teacher; class IntegrationTest extends \PHPUnit_Framework_TestCase { /** @var ManagerRegistry */ private $registry; /** @var Serializer */ private $serializer; public function testDiscriminatorIsInferredForEntityBaseClass() { $school = new School(); $json = $this->serializer->serialize($school, 'json'); $this->assertEquals('{"type":"school"}', $json); $deserialized = $this->serializer->deserialize($json, Organization::class, 'json'); $this->assertEquals($school, $deserialized); } public function testDiscriminatorIsInferredForGenericBaseClass() { $student = new Student(); $json = $this->serializer->serialize($student, 'json'); $this->assertEquals('{"type":"student"}', $json); $deserialized = $this->serializer->deserialize($json, Person::class, 'json'); $this->assertEquals($student, $deserialized); } public function testDiscriminatorIsInferredFromDoctrine() { /** @var EntityManager $em */ $em = $this->registry->getManager(); $student1 = new Student(); $student2 = new Student(); $teacher = new Teacher(); $class = new Clazz($teacher, array($student1, $student2)); $em->persist($student1); $em->persist($student2); $em->persist($teacher); $em->persist($class); $em->flush(); $em->clear(); $reloadedClass = $em->find(get_class($class), $class->getId()); $this->assertNotSame($class, $reloadedClass); $json = $this->serializer->serialize($reloadedClass, 'json'); $this->assertEquals('{"id":1,"teacher":{"id":1,"type":"teacher"},"students":[{"id":2,"type":"student"},{"id":3,"type":"student"}]}', $json); } protected function setUp() { $connection = $this->createConnection(); $entityManager = $this->createEntityManager($connection); $this->registry = $registry = new SimpleManagerRegistry( function ($id) use ($connection, $entityManager) { switch ($id) { case 'default_connection': return $connection; case 'default_manager': return $entityManager; default: throw new \RuntimeException(sprintf('Unknown service id "%s".', $id)); } } ); $this->serializer = SerializerBuilder::create() ->setMetadataDriverFactory(new CallbackDriverFactory( function (array $metadataDirs, Reader $annotationReader) use ($registry) { $defaultFactory = new DefaultDriverFactory(); return new DoctrineTypeDriver($defaultFactory->createDriver($metadataDirs, $annotationReader), $registry); } )) ->build(); $this->prepareDatabase(); } private function prepareDatabase() { /** @var EntityManager $em */ $em = $this->registry->getManager(); $tool = new SchemaTool($em); $tool->createSchema($em->getMetadataFactory()->getAllMetadata()); } private function createConnection() { $con = DriverManager::getConnection(array( 'driver' => 'pdo_sqlite', 'memory' => true, )); return $con; } private function createEntityManager(Connection $con) { $cfg = new Configuration(); $cfg->setMetadataDriverImpl(new AnnotationDriver(new AnnotationReader(), array( __DIR__ . '/../../Fixtures/Doctrine/SingleTableInheritance', ))); $cfg->setAutoGenerateProxyClasses(true); $cfg->setProxyNamespace('JMS\Serializer\DoctrineProxy'); $cfg->setProxyDir(sys_get_temp_dir() . '/serializer-test-proxies'); $em = EntityManager::create($con, $cfg); return $em; } } class SimpleManagerRegistry extends AbstractManagerRegistry { private $services = array(); private $serviceCreator; public function __construct($serviceCreator, $name = 'anonymous', array $connections = array('default' => 'default_connection'), array $managers = array('default' => 'default_manager'), $defaultConnection = null, $defaultManager = null, $proxyInterface = 'Doctrine\Common\Persistence\Proxy') { if (null === $defaultConnection) { $defaultConnection = key($connections); } if (null === $defaultManager) { $defaultManager = key($managers); } parent::__construct($name, $connections, $managers, $defaultConnection, $defaultManager, $proxyInterface); if (!is_callable($serviceCreator)) { throw new \InvalidArgumentException('$serviceCreator must be a valid callable.'); } $this->serviceCreator = $serviceCreator; } public function getService($name) { if (isset($this->services[$name])) { return $this->services[$name]; } return $this->services[$name] = call_user_func($this->serviceCreator, $name); } public function resetService($name) { unset($this->services[$name]); } public function getAliasNamespace($alias) { foreach (array_keys($this->getManagers()) as $name) { $manager = $this->getManager($name); if ($manager instanceof EntityManager) { try { return $manager->getConfiguration()->getEntityNamespace($alias); } catch (ORMException $ex) { // Probably mapped by another entity manager, or invalid, just ignore this here. } } else { throw new \LogicException(sprintf('Unsupported manager type "%s".', get_class($manager))); } } throw new \RuntimeException(sprintf('The namespace alias "%s" is not known to any manager.', $alias)); } }
